Abstract

3-Hydroxy-3-methylglutaryl coenzyme A reductase (HMGR, EC: 1.1.1.34) catalyzes the first committed step in mevalonic acid (MVA) pathway for biosynthesis of isoprenoids. The full-length cDNA encoding HMGR was isolated from Jatropha curcas for the first time (designated as JcHMGR), which contained a 1950 bp ORF encoding 584 amino acids. The JcHMGR genomic DNA sequence was also obtained, revealing JcHMGR had 4 exons and 3 introns. The deduced JcHMGR protein showed high identity to other plant HMGRs and contained 2 transmembrane domains and a catalytic domain. The potential significance of JcHMGR gene was also discussed.
